Rotewheel reads its configuration entirely from the environment; no config files are parsed at runtime, which keeps the audit surface small. Required variables cover the vault endpoint, the rotation interval, and the dry-run flag (defaults to true — reviewers should verify this stays on in non-production). Rotation schedules are validated at startup and logged before any write occurs. The utility also needs a bootstrap credential to authenticate its first vault call; the env file defines it on the next line.

sealed setting: ARCHIVE_KEY3=8d0

## Runbook: Ferrowing circuit breaker — upstream Petalgrid API

When the Petalgrid API degrades, the Ferrowing circuit breaker opens after 5 consecutive failures and serves cached responses for 60 seconds before half-open probing. Support: if customers report stale data, check the breaker state first — don't restart the gateway, that resets the failure counters and masks the issue. Breaker state transitions are logged to the ops database for audit. To query recent transitions, connect using the string below.

replica DSN, kajep-yahag: mssql://praok_svc:iF@db-8d68.plorvaio.local:5432/eliion

## Deploying role-based access

Heads up, future maintainer: the Quillpad wiki's RBAC module is deployed separately from the main app. Roles sync from the Tarnfield directory on a cron, so don't panic if a new editor can't save for a few minutes. Run the sync job manually after any role-mapping change. The deployment reads its settings at boot, shown below.

config for yajep-tafof:
[rusath]
team = julmir
access_code = ac_fe37fd
host = rusath.novactech.test
port = 8000
owner = pelmir.weneth
peer = oliwyn.olvarqdyn.internal

HANDOVER — Commission Scheme Revision

To the incoming director: the revised scheme goes live on the 1st. Key changes: accelerators start at 110% of quota, not 100%; multi-year Quillstone deals pay out over term, not upfront; clawbacks extend to nine months. Reps were briefed last week — expect pushback from the Ashgrove pod. Payroll mapping is done; Tomas owns the calculator. Disputes route through RevOps, not you. One outstanding item: the enterprise override rate is unresolved. Background for that decision sits below.

internal memo for kahif-kawig: Project Fravan slips by two quarters because of the tooling delay.